- Provides age-appropriate nursing care under the supervision of a Registered Nurse (RN) or designated provider, applying basic knowledge of biological, physical, behavioral, social, and nursing sciences to meet the needs of individuals and groups.
- Collections and monitors patient data, including packaging and obtaining specimens and labs, contributing to assessments and promptly communicates abnormal findings or changes in condition to the appropriate provider.
- Participates in developing and implementing patient care and discharge plans under RN direction, delivers nursing care and treatments as ordered, and assists with personal care and activities of daily living to maintain hygiene and nutrition.
- Safely administers prescribed medications, injections, and treatments while monitoring for adverse reactions, and ensures all provider orders are followed for patient treatment.
- Provides education to patients, families, and caregivers regarding health, treatments, and self-care.
- Documents all aspects of patient care in accordance with hospital policies and nursing care standards.
- Adheres to regulatory standards and Akron Children’s Hospital (ACH) policies, maintains a safe and clean environment, and reports safety concerns as appropriate.
- Works collaboratively as a member of the patient care team, engages in ongoing education and professional development, and performs additional duties to support efficient operations and quality patient care.

- Education and Experience:
- Education: Graduate from an accredited school of licensed practical nursing.
- Licensure: Current, valid LPN license in the state of Ohio.
- Certification: Basic Life Support (BLS) certification from the American Heart Association. Additional certifications (e.g., PEARS, PALS, ACLS, TNCC, NRP) may be required based on assignment or department/unit.
- Years of relevant experience: Minimum one (1) year of relevant experience is preferred.
